Engine Timing Cover(s) - Removal






REMOVAL










1. Disconnect the battery negative cable.
2. Drain cooling system Service and Repair.
3. Disconnect both heater hoses at timing cover.
4. Disconnect lower radiator hose at engine.
5. Remove crankshaft damper Vibration Damper - Removal.
6. Remove accessory drive belt tensioner assembly (1).
7. Remove the generator and A/C compressor.






CAUTION: The 4.7L engine uses an RTV sealer instead of a gasket to seal the front cover to the engine block, from the factory. For service, Mopar(R) Grey Engine RTV sealant must be substituted.

NOTE: It is not necessary to remove the water pump for timing cover removal.

8. Remove the bolts holding the timing cover to engine block.
9. Remove cover.
